Course details

• E-commerce Inventory Management: This unit covers the fundamentals of inventory management in e-commerce, including understanding inventory types, managing stock levels, and optimizing inventory turnover. • Supply Chain Optimization: This unit focuses on streamlining the supply chain process to improve efficiency, reduce costs, and enhance customer satisfaction. It covers topics such as demand forecasting, inventory replenishment, and logistics management. • Inventory Control Systems: This unit explores the different types of inventory control systems, including manual, automated, and hybrid systems. It also covers the implementation and maintenance of these systems. • E-commerce Operations Management: This unit delves into the operational aspects of e-commerce, including order management, shipping, and returns. It covers topics such as order fulfillment, inventory allocation, and customer service. • Data Analysis for Inventory Management: This unit teaches students how to collect, analyze, and interpret data to inform inventory management decisions. It covers topics such as data visualization, statistical analysis, and data-driven decision-making. • E-commerce Inventory Management Software: This unit covers the different types of e-commerce inventory management software, including cloud-based, on-premise, and hybrid solutions. It also explores the features and functionalities of these software solutions. • Inventory Management Best Practices: This unit highlights the best practices for inventory management in e-commerce, including implementing a first-in-first-out (FIFO) inventory system, conducting regular inventory audits, and maintaining accurate inventory records. • E-commerce Logistics and Shipping: This unit covers the logistics and shipping aspects of e-commerce, including transportation management, warehousing, and delivery. It also explores the impact of Brexit on e-commerce logistics. • E-commerce Customer Service: This unit focuses on providing excellent customer service in e-commerce, including handling customer inquiries, resolving issues, and managing returns and refunds. • E-commerce Business Intelligence: This unit teaches students how to use business intelligence tools and techniques to analyze e-commerce data and make informed business decisions. It covers topics such as data mining, predictive analytics, and business process optimization.

Career path

E-commerce Inventory Manager Responsible for managing inventory levels, optimizing stockroom space, and ensuring timely delivery of products to customers.
Supply Chain Coordinator Coordinates the movement of goods, products, and resources from one place to another, ensuring efficient and cost-effective supply chain operations.
Logistics Manager Oversees the planning, coordination, and execution of logistics operations, including transportation, warehousing, and inventory management.
Inventory Analyst Analyzes inventory data to identify trends, optimize stock levels, and improve supply chain efficiency, ensuring accurate and timely inventory reporting.
